The bioflavonoid troxerutin prevents gestational hypertension in mice by inhibiting STAT3 signaling.

Abstract

Gestational hypertension is a high-risk disease for women, and the current treatments have limited efficacies. Here, we aimed to evaluate troxerutin, which is a natural monomer of flavone, in the treatment of gestational hypertension. Pregnant mice with or without pregnancy-induced hypertension (PIH) were treated with troxerutin (20 and 40 mg/kg) or vehicle. Blood pressure and proteinuria were monitored during treatment. The expression of vasodilation converting enzyme (VCE), angiotensin, TNFα, IL-6, IL-1β and IL-10 was measured by enzyme-linked immunosorbent assay (ELISA). Oxidative stress was assessed by measuring the reactive oxygen species (ROS) levels and antioxidant enzyme concentrations. Western blot analysis was used to assess the expression of p-STAT3, STAT3, SHP-1, and RNF6. Troxerutin reduced blood pressure and the expression of VCE, angiotensin, urinary protein and pro-inflammatory cytokines in a dose-dependent manner while increasing the expression of anti-inflammatory cytokines. The levels of ROS were decreased, and the levels of antioxidant enzymes were increased. Troxerutin treatment significantly suppressed STAT3/RNF6 signaling. Overexpression of RNF6 attenuated the effects of troxerutin in ameliorating inflammation and oxidative stress. Our data support the use of troxerutin for reducing gestational hypertension due to the role of troxerutin in reducing inflammation and oxidative stress.

摘要

妊娠期高血压是一种对女性健康具有高度风险的疾病,目前的治疗方法疗效有限。在这里,我们旨在评估曲克芦丁,一种黄酮类的天然单体,在治疗妊娠期高血压中的作用。有或没有妊娠高血压(PIH)的怀孕小鼠用曲克芦丁(20 和 40mg/kg)或载体处理。在治疗过程中监测血压和蛋白尿。通过酶联免疫吸附测定(ELISA)测量血管舒张转化酶(VCE)、血管紧张素、TNFα、IL-6、IL-1β和 IL-10 的表达。通过测量活性氧(ROS)水平和抗氧化酶浓度来评估氧化应激。Western blot 分析用于评估 p-STAT3、STAT3、SHP-1 和 RNF6 的表达。曲克芦丁以剂量依赖性方式降低血压和 VCE、血管紧张素、尿蛋白和促炎细胞因子的表达,同时增加抗炎细胞因子的表达。ROS 水平降低,抗氧化酶水平升高。曲克芦丁处理显著抑制了 STAT3/RNF6 信号通路。RNF6 的过表达减弱了曲克芦丁改善炎症和氧化应激的作用。我们的数据支持使用曲克芦丁来降低妊娠期高血压,因为曲克芦丁在减轻炎症和氧化应激方面发挥了作用。
